Samsung Galaxy S25 vs S26, S25+ vs S26+ comparison tables leak

If you're wondering how the upcoming Samsung Galaxy S26 will differ from the already available S25, or the S26+ from the S25+, you're in luck as the prolific leaker Ice Universe has just provided this information in the form of two comparison tables, which you can see below.

So, if this information is accurate, then the Galaxy S26 will have a marginally bigger screen than its predecessor, with the same peak brightness and refresh rate, the same RAM amount, the same cameras, a 300mAh larger battery, and the same charging support.

It will be 2g heavier and 0.3mm thinner, while packing a newer chipset. It will also apparently drop the 128GB version to start at 256GB, but like the S25, it will also only go up to 512GB.

Compared to the S25+, the S26+ has the same screen size and resolution and brightness and refresh rate, the same memory and storage amounts, the same cameras, the same battery capacity and charging support, and the same thickness too. The only notable difference is the new chipset and the fact that the S26+ is 4g heavier than its predecessor, otherwise they seem identical on paper.
